  • Catalytic Converter Thefts

    The following message was sent to parking permit holders on the Columbus campus. Theft of catalytic converters from cars is becoming an issue not just at Ohio State but around the city of Columbus and the country. Since September 2021, more than 40 reports of catalytic converter thefts have been made to OSUPD. Please be on the lookout for suspicious activity in parking lots and garages and if you...

  • Lyft Ride Smart service hours expanded

    Lyft Ride Smart at Ohio State is expanding hours for a second time as Ohio State continues to offer safety enhancements on and off campus. Service will now start earlier each day, and run from 7 p.m. to 7 a.m., seven days a week.
